Chelsea are reportedly set to lodge a €32 million bid for Montpellier striker Elye Wahi, who is also a subject of interest from Arsenal.

Chelsea are set to launch a hefty bid worth around €32 million for Montpellier hitman Elye Wahi. That’s according to a report from French outlet RMC Sport, which claims that the Blues are likely to launch the offensive for Wahi very soon despite the fact that cross-London rivals Arsenal have made contact for the signing of the 20-year-old.

Regarded as one of the hottest young properties in European football, Wahi made quite an impact in Ligue 1 last season, notching 19 goals — up from 10 the season before — and recording six assists in 33 appearances as Michel Der Zakarian’s side finished 12th in Ligue 1 despite sacking two managers during the season.

A classic fox in the box in terms of taking his chances but equally comfortable carrying the ball and taking on opponents, the Frenchman looks to possess world-class potential.

Indeed, after his stellar showings in the 2022/23 campaign, several top clubs, including Paris Saint-Germain and Atletico Madrid, have expressed interest in securing Wahi’s signature. There is also no shortage of well-stocked Premier League suitors willing to splash the cash to secure his services.

Arsenal, for one, have been consistently linked with a move for Wahi over recent weeks and months. Although not in dire need of attacking reinforcements ahead of next season, the Gunners could do with some more depth in the striking department, as they currently have Gabriel Jesus as the only proven striker in their squad.

They view Wahi as a backup in that position who could also serve as an understudy to the Brazilian international and compete for the starting spot. However, signing Wahi just would not make much sense right now unless they are planning to offload both Eddie Nketiah and Folarin Balogun, the latter of whom enjoyed a 21-goal season in the same league as Wahi last term.

Nevertheless, Chelsea have now emerged as the frontrunner in the race for the young striker, as they are preparing a sizeable bid for the France Under-21 international. The report adds that the Blues plan is to loan the French prodigy out to Strasbourg once a deal is complete. But the player does not share the same idea and would rather move straight into Mauricio Pochettino’s first team.

Todd Boehly and BlueCo recently completed a full takeover of the Alsace-based Ligue 1 outfit and are also looking to loan Angelo Gabriel to Patrick Vieira’s side after signing the Brazilian wonderkid from Santos. It remains to be seen whether Chelsea’s opening offer will be enough to get the deal done. But this one is worth keeping an eye on as the Blues look to wrap up Wahi this week.
